Demand for Resignations of Pete Hegseth and Mike Waltz

To: Sen. Merkley, Sen. Wyden, Rep. Bentz

From: A verified voter in Myrtle Creek, OR

March 25

The recent revelation that Secretary of Defense Pete Hegseth and National Security Advisor Mike Waltz recklessly discussed sensitive military operations over unsecured communications is an unforgivable breach of duty. Their negligence has endangered national security, violated multiple federal records laws, and shattered any remaining trust in this administration’s ability to govern responsibly. This is not just incompetence—it is a direct violation of the Presidential Records Act (PRA), the Federal Records Act (FRA), and national security protocols designed to protect our country from internal corruption and external threats. The use of unsecured, private messaging apps to discuss military plans, leading to their accidental disclosure to a journalist, is a level of recklessness that demands immediate accountability. These officials knowingly circumvented the law and put American lives at risk in the process. Given the gravity of this breach, I demand that you take immediate action by: 1. Calling for the immediate resignations of Secretary Pete Hegseth and National Security Advisor Mike Waltz. Their continued presence in office is a national security liability. 2. Launching a full congressional investigation into the use of unauthorized communication channels within the executive branch, ensuring that those responsible are held fully accountable. 3. Holding public hearings to expose the extent of this lawlessness to the American people. 4. Enacting legislative measures to prevent such reckless disregard for national security from happening again. Enough is enough. We cannot allow officials who blatantly ignore the law and endanger national security to remain in power. If Congress fails to act, it will be complicit in this dangerous erosion of accountability. I, along with countless others, will be watching your response closely and will not accept inaction. The American people demand justice. We demand accountability. And we demand it now.
